使用按钮、HtmlButtons和LinkButtons的onclick/onserverclick的问题。
- 按钮:按钮是一种常用的HTML元素,用于触发特定的操作或事件。在前端开发中,我们可以通过onclick事件来绑定按钮点击时执行的JavaScript代码。在后端开发中,我们可以通过onserverclick事件来绑定按钮点击时执行的服务器端代码。
- onclick: 当按钮被点击时,触发此事件。可以使用JavaScript代码来定义按钮点击时的行为,例如弹窗、页面跳转等。点击按钮后,浏览器会执行相应的JavaScript代码。
- onserverclick: 当按钮被点击时,触发此事件。可以使用服务器端代码来处理按钮点击的逻辑,例如执行某个操作、调用数据库等。点击按钮后,会向服务器发送请求,服务器端会执行相应的代码并返回结果给浏览器。
应用场景:按钮常用于用户交互,如提交表单、触发某个操作、导航等。可以在网页中添加按钮,通过onclick事件执行前端代码;也可以在服务器端处理按钮点击事件,通过onserverclick事件执行后端代码。
推荐的腾讯云相关产品:腾讯云云服务器(CVM)、腾讯云函数计算(SCF)。
- 腾讯云云服务器(CVM):提供可扩展的虚拟云服务器,适用于网站托管、应用程序部署、数据库管理等场景。详情请参考:腾讯云云服务器产品页
- 腾讯云函数计算(SCF):无服务器计算服务,可以快速部署和运行代码,按实际使用量付费。适用于事件驱动的应用程序、后端逻辑处理等场景。详情请参考:腾讯云函数计算产品页
- HtmlButtons:HtmlButtons是指在HTML页面中使用的按钮元素,可以通过设置其onclick属性来绑定按钮点击时执行的JavaScript代码。HtmlButtons可以实现前端交互逻辑,如页面跳转、表单验证等。
应用场景:HtmlButtons常用于前端页面中的用户交互,如提交表单、触发特定操作、切换页面等。
推荐的腾讯云相关产品:腾讯云移动推送(信鸽推送)、腾讯云直播(云直播)。
- 腾讯云移动推送(信鸽推送):提供全球覆盖的消息推送服务,适用于App推送通知、消息推送等场景。详情请参考:腾讯云移动推送产品页
- 腾讯云直播(云直播):提供高可靠、低延迟的视频直播服务,适用于直播互动、在线教育、游戏直播等场景。详情请参考:腾讯云直播产品页
- LinkButtons:LinkButtons是一种特殊的按钮,通常用于在网页中创建类似于超链接的按钮样式。通过设置其onclick属性或onserverclick属性来绑定按钮点击时执行的JavaScript代码或服务器端代码。
应用场景:LinkButtons常用于需要同时具备超链接和按钮功能的场景,比如跳转页面、执行某个操作等。
推荐的腾讯云相关产品:腾讯云内容分发网络(CDN)、腾讯云对象存储(COS)。
- 腾讯云内容分发网络(CDN):提供全球加速的内容分发网络服务,加速静态资源的传输,适用于网站加速、音视频分发等场景。详情请参考:腾讯云内容分发网络产品页
- 腾讯云对象存储(COS):提供安全可靠的对象存储服务,用于存储和管理海量结构化和非结构化数据,适用于数据备份、图片存储等场景。详情请参考:腾讯云对象存储产品页